Wrong documentation regarding Asset Server
User reported a mistake in our documentation page. He pointed out that the line
"To access the Administrator controls, launch Unity and select Window->Asset Server, then click the Administration button." in http://docs.unity3d.com/Manual/SettinguptheAssetServer.html
is incorrect. I checked and can verify that the the window is now named Version Control and not Asset Server anymore. In the parent documentation page the path is correct ("http://docs.unity3d.com/Manual/AssetServer.html From the menubar, select Window->Version Control")
To reproduce:
1) Go to Edit -> Project Settings -> Editor
2) In the Version control Mode tab select Asset Server
3) In the Window tab you won't find Asset Server, only Version control which serves the same function
